Stress Laundering Timber Surfaces
When stress washing wood surface areas, it's crucial to select the best tools and method to stay clear of damages. Begin by choosing a pressure washer with flexible setups. A lower stress, generally between 1,200 to 1,500 PSI, is perfect for timber. This aids stop gouging or removing the timber fibers.
Prior to you start, make sure to get rid of the area of furnishings, plants, and other barriers. It's essential to examine a little, unnoticeable area initially to ensure your method and stress setups will not hurt the surface.

Techniques for Cleansing Concrete
Concrete surface areas can gather dirt, grime, and spots in time, making efficient cleaning techniques essential. To begin, you'll want to make use of a stress washing machine with a minimum of 3000 PSI for concrete cleaning. This degree of stress effectively removes persistent discolorations without harming the surface area.
Before you begin, spray the location with a concrete cleaner or a mix of cleaning agent and water. Allow it to dwell for regarding 10-15 minutes; this aids break down hard stains.
Next off, connect a wide spray nozzle to your pressure washing machine, preferably a 25-degree or 40-degree pointer. This will distribute the water evenly and lessen the risk of etching.
When you start stress cleaning, work in areas. Maintain the nozzle regarding 12 inches from the surface and keep a constant, sweeping activity. This method ensures you do not miss any kind of places or use too much stress in one location.
For particularly stubborn discolorations, you might need to repeat the process or utilize an extra concentrated cleaner.
Lastly, wash the location extensively after cleaning. This action avoids any deposit from staying on the concrete, leaving it tidy and looking fresh.
Best Practices for Plastic Home Siding
Plastic house siding is a popular choice for homeowners due to its durability and reduced maintenance requirements. Nonetheless, to maintain it looking its best, you'll require to press wash it regularly.
Begin by preparing the area-- get rid of any kind of furnishings, plants, or barriers near your home. Next off, choose a stress washer with a nozzle that provides a broad spray; commonly, a 25-degree nozzle works well.
Before you start, check a small area to ensure your setups will not damage the exterior siding. Begin with the bottom and work your means up, cleaning in sections to stop streaks.
Use a cleaning agent particularly formulated for vinyl exterior siding to assist remove dust and mold. Apply it with your pressure washer or a pump sprayer, permitting it to sit for around 10 minutes.
Afterward, wash thoroughly from the top down, ensuring all cleaning agent is removed. Finally, examine the exterior siding for any kind of missed areas or persistent stains that might require additional attention.
Normal maintenance will certainly keep your plastic house siding looking fresh and extend its life expectancy, making it a beneficial financial investment for your home.
